    Cannabis Laws, Prohibition Legacy, and Enforcement in the Modern Era

    To truly get why a police marijuana trunk arrest is still making news in 2024, you need background on cannabis law in Pennsylvania, and the country at large. State law here keeps recreational use firmly on the wrong side of legality, despite neighboring states pushing toward sensible reform (Marijuana Policy Project). Medical use is permitted under strict control, but there’s no broad legalization. Social attitudes, though, are shifting. Nearly 60% of Pennsylvanians now support adult-use legalization, according to Pew Research. At the same time, states such as Ohio have recently taken steps that highlight how prohibition-era restrictions can still emerge, as evidenced by the ongoing changes around Ohio’s THC product ban and the impact it’s having on users across state lines.

    • Federal prohibition means cannabis remains a Schedule I drug, complicating enforcement at local levels.
    • Market demand for legal cannabis products in the U.S. hit $26 billion in 2022, per MJBizDaily.
    • Law enforcement’s priorities are increasingly debated as public opinion and fiscal realities shift.

    The Traffic Stop: Facts, Timeline, and Legal Fallout

    Let’s dive into the nuts and bolts of the recent police marijuana trunk arrest that’s got the cannabis community talking. According to NorthCentral PA News, the incident went down on a quiet roadside in Lycoming County, Pennsylvania. Here’s how it played out:

    1. On June 11, 2024, a Pennsylvania State Police officer pulled over a man for a minor traffic issue.
    2. The driver, surprisingly forthcoming, allegedly told the officer he had ‘a few pounds of marijuana’ in the trunk.
    3. The officer found multiple bags packed with cannabis flower during a lawful search.
    4. Authorities seized the cannabis, and the man now faces felony possession and intent-to-distribute charges.

    This case is a textbook illustration of how nonviolent cannabis offenses get processed under existing law. The details, posted by NorthCentral PA, reveal both the ongoing enforcement pressures and an oddly casual approach from the defendant, maybe a sign of shifting attitudes, even among those facing the law.
